Pia Degermark

Pia Degermark

Born: August 24, 1949
in Bromma, Stockhom, Sweden
Pia Charlotte Degermark is a Swedish former actress. She is best known for her role as Elvira Madigan in the 1967 drama film Elvira Madigan, for which she won a Cannes Film Festival Award for Best Actress. Wikipedia
